Glyptodon rudis

Mammalia - Cingulata - Glyptodontidae

Taxonomy
Glyptodon rudis was named by Gervais (1878).

It was recombined as Euryurus rudis by Gervais and Ameghino (1880); it was synonymized subjectively with Panochthus tuberculatus by Lydekker (1894); it was recombined as Neuryurus rudis by Ameghino (1889), Ameghino (1889) and Soibelzon et al. (2010).
